July 27, 2025, was one of those. The Gurucool Book of the Year Awards made its return for a second edition, right in the heart of Hyderabad. It wasn’t just an event; it was a celebration of words, voices, and the indelible power of stories.


In a time defined by quick scrolls and flowing attention, this evening felt like a deep, calming breath which is a rare pause to truly listen, feel, and remember why stories matter.

Organized by Gurucool Publishing, the awards this year honored 63 authors, each of them a story into themselves, each carrying the fire of ideas, narratives, and emotions that deserve to be read and remembered.
